Fellow
Lions, Lionesses, Leos and friends and family, it is my pleasure
to welcome you to the place where Lions clubs became an international
organization when the first club outside of the United States
was formed in Windsor, Ontario, Canada. During this 87th International
Convention in Detroit, Michigan, USA and Windsor, Ontario,
Canada, there will be many opportunities to share innovative
ideas, attend informative seminars and enjoy all that our
host cities have to offer.
